Requirements































Responsibilities

  • Demonstrate respect for the Catholic and Franciscan values of the university.

  • Demonstrate the ability to relate effectively to student-athletes, coaches, staff, administration and the University community.

  • Participate in and promote a culture of continuing quality improvement.

  • Assumption of coaching responsibilities related to the sport of softball.

  • Assumption of certain administrative responsibilities related to the sport of softball.

  • Provision of assistance in monitoring the academic progress of student-athletes.

  • Provision of assistance in the enforcement of team rules.

  • Provision of assistance in the planning, development and conducting of all in-season and off-season practices and conditioning sessions.

  • Ensure that proper safety guidelines and standards are maintained.

  • Coordinate certain strategy related to sport of softball.

  • Responsible for certain aspects of recruitment in accordance with university and NAIA rules.

  • Understanding and support of all athletic policies and regulations, as well as all philosophies, of the university, Chicagoland Collegiate Athletic Conference and National Association of Intercollegiate Athletics.

  • Understanding and support of the NAIA Champions of Character Coaches Code.

  • Represent the athletic department and university in a professional manner at various internal and external functions and in working with internal and external constituencies, including but not limited to the media and general public.

  • Perform other administrative duties within the department as assigned.

  • Must be able to work nights, weekends and holidays.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ree.

  • Acceptance into USF's masters program with the exception of Albuquerque, NM campus.

  • Ability to perform the physical requirements of the position.

  • Ability and willingness to work nights, weekends and holidays.

  • Willingness to support the Catholic and Franciscan values of the University.

Pay Rate Hourly$5,000 Stipend (up to 20 hours of work per week as needed) & Tuition Waiver (total graduate credits cannot exceed 18 graduate credit hours per academic year)
Benefits
Hours / WeekVaries based on softball practice & game schedules; includes weekends, nights & holidays.
